Description: Methylmalonic Acid Blood Test (Labcorp) A Methylmalonic Acid (MMA) Blood test is most often used to aid in the diagnosis of Vitamin B12 deficiency. Methylmalonic Acid production is linked to the body's Vitamin B12 level. When B12 levels drop, more MMA is produced. An MMA test is one of the earliest indicators of Vitamin B12 deficiency. This test measures the amount of a substance called methylmalonic acid (MMA) in your blood. MMA is typically made in tiny amounts when you digest protein. Your body makes large amounts of MMA if you have a drop in the amount of vitamin B-12. MMA is excreted through your kidneys. Your body needs B-12 to make red blood cells and to help your ...

Methylmalonic acid (MMA) is determined by liquid chromatography tandem mass spectrometry (LC-MS/MS) stable isotope dilution analysis. The specimen is mixed with an internal standard (methyl-d3-malonic acid). MMA and d3-MMA are isolated by solid phase extraction. LC-MS/MS is performed using mobile phases and a short column to separate MMA and d3 ...

In this approach, a second-line assay (vitamin B12) falls in an "equivocal" range. It has been suggested that boarderline B12 levels (200-400 ng/L) should be followed up with measuring methylmalonic acid levels. Methylmalonic acid levels below the upper limit of the reference range (0-378 nmol/L) are strongly suggestive of normal B12 status.

Intrinsic factor is a glycoprotein (produced by the parietal cells of the stomach) that is required for the absorption of vitamin B 12 from the diet. 1 During digestion, stomach acids dissociate B 12 from food and intrinsic factor binds to it and allows it to be absorbed in the small intestine.
